First, I recreated a part of my site using Flash. I uploaded it to make sure it displayed properly. However, after I began to add the links, they weren't working. After checking a few things, I determined that firefox wasn't updating the page, because all of my updates display in Internet Explorer, but not in Firefox. I have tested this on multiple pages and multiple computers, and the same thing happens. Does anyone know why this is happening, or how to fix it?

Second, this is just a small issue, but whenever you type in a directory without a slash at the end, it goes to the subdomain. When you add the slash, it uses the top-level domain (which is what I want). Example:
sobecknetworks.com/tech/forums --> sobecknetworks.x10hosting.com/tech/forums/index.php
sobecknetworks.com/tech/forums/ --> sobecknetworks.com/tech/forums/index.php
Does anyone have any ideas on how to fix this?
